Sendwave (part of the Zepz group, alongside WorldRemit) is a mobile-first app advertising zero transfer fees on many corridors, focused on fast delivery to bank accounts and mobile wallets in Africa and Asia.

Fees & exchange rate

Sendwave typically charges no transfer fee, earning on the exchange rate instead. Because there's no fee, the recipient amount is the only fair basis for comparison.

Delivery & speed

Delivery: Mobile wallet, bank account.
Payment methods: Debit card, Bank transfer.
Speed: Often minutes to same day.

Pros & cons

Pros

  • Zero transfer fees on many corridors
  • Fast mobile-wallet delivery
  • Simple, well-rated app

Cons

  • · Value depends entirely on the exchange rate
  • · Does not serve every destination (e.g. not Ethiopia)
  • · App-first — limited web experience
